WWE superstar Becky Lynch is officially part of the cast of Star Trek: Starfleet Academy on Paramount Plus, Lynch announced via social media on December 12th.

“You know when you’ve already been champion of the world, there’s only one place to go next, and that’s to the stars,” Lynch said in a video on X. “I’m so excited to share with all of you that I’m joining Star Trek: Starfleet Academy as part of the bridge crew. This has been the most amazing experience, acting alongside just a spectacular cast and crew, and I cannot wait for all of you to check it out when it comes out on Paramount Plus.” She concluded with a Vulcan salute, saying, “Live long and prosper.”

Lynch, who has been on a hiatus from WWE for more than 200 days, is one of the most decorated women’s wrestlers in history. Her acting credits include roles in Showtime’s Billions and NBC’s Young Rock.

The Starfleet Academy series, set to follow a new class of Starfleet cadets, features Kerrice Brooks, Bella Shepard, George Hawkins, Sandro Rosta, Karim Diané, and Zoë Steiner. Holly Hunter will play the academy’s captain and chancellor, with Paul Giamatti cast as the season’s main villain. Additionally, Tig Notaro, Mary Wiseman, and Oded Fehr from Star Trek: Discovery, as well as Robert Picardo from Star Trek: Voyager, will reprise their roles. Orphan Black star Tatiana Maslany will guest star.

The series has already been renewed for a second season, although no premiere date has been announced.

The show’s logline reveals that Starfleet Academy will chronicle “the adventures of a new class of Starfleet cadets as they come of age in one of the most legendary places in the galaxy. Under the watchful and demanding eyes of their instructors, they will discover what it takes to become Starfleet officers as they navigate blossoming friendships, explosive rivalries, first loves and a new enemy that threatens both the Academy and the Federation itself.”
